Transaction 21678512866aa94295c5f2e65d747f2ceb3738904c94ded890988a539388dffd
1 Input
1 Output
-
21678512866aa94295c5f2e65d747f2ceb3738904c94ded890988a539388dffd:0
- value
- 178000
- script pubkey
- OP_0 OP_PUSHBYTES_20 66f21c7784f2dde1e0c4eaf0001e489734a2d02a
- address
- bc1qvmepcauy7tw7rcxyatcqq8jgju6295p2m5urtq